A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

爱听故事的咖啡

初级黑马

  • 黑马币:

  • 帖子:

  • 精华:

© 爱听故事的咖啡 初级黑马   /  2019-3-29 22:46  /  593 人查看  /  0 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

作为93年的咖啡,也工作过好几年了,试过挺多不同的岗位 。年轻的时候,觉得工作体面轻松就好工资多少无所谓。然而随着年龄的长大  明白了现实生活也是需要面包的 也为了提高自己的生活水平。之所以选择黑马 之前有朋友在这里培训过 现在他天天喝咖啡听故事。我也想听故事 所以我就来了黑马。


package zuoye0329;

import java.util.Scanner;

public class text03 {
    public static void main(String[] args) {
        int[] arr=new int[5];
        Scanner sc=new Scanner(System.in);
        for(int i=0;i<arr.length;i++){
            System.out.println("请输入第"+(i+1)+"个数组");
            arr[i]=sc.nextInt();
        }
        int n=getNum(arr);
        System.out.println(n);

        System.out.println(getNum(arr));

    }

    public static int getNum(int[] arr) {
        //1.1 获取指定数组arr中元素值为偶数的累加和
        int sum1 = 0;//偶数
        int sum2 = 0;//奇数
        for (int i = 0; i < arr.length; i++) {
            if (arr[i] / 2 == 0) {
                sum1 = sum1 + 1;
            } else if (arr[i]/2==1){// 为什么是else的时候 不执sum2=sum2+1
                sum2 = sum2 + 1;
            }
            // 为什么是else的时候 不执sum2=sum2+1
           /* else {
                sum2 = sum2 + 1;
            }*/


        }
        if (sum1 - sum2 > 0) {
            int a = sum1 - sum2;//定义a是奇数和偶数的差值
            return a;
        } else {
            int a = sum2 - sum1;
            return a;
        }

    }
}



package zuoye0329;
import java.util.Random;
//参数是    数组
//返回值是  int
public class text04 {
    public static void main(String[] args) {
        int[] arr = {1, 3, 4, 5, 0, 0, 6, 6, 0, 5, 4, 7, 6, 7, 0, 5};
        int s = tiHuang(arr);
        System.out.println(s);
    }

    public static int tiHuang(int[] arr) {
        Random r = new Random();
        //定义方法将数组中的0使用1-10之间的随机数替换掉(每一个0都要用一个新的随机数替换),
        // 并统计替换了多少个。
        int a = 0;
        for (int i = 0; i < arr.length; i++) {
            if (arr[i] == 0) {//判断是否等于0
                arr[i] = r.nextInt(10) + 1;
                a = a + 1;
            }
            System.out.print(arr[i] + " ");
        }
        System.out.println();
        return a;
    }
}


package zuoye0329;

public class text09 {
    public static void main(String[] args) {
        int[] arr = {1, 2, 3, 4, 5, 6, 7};
        int[] arr1 = {2, 3, 4, 5, 6, 7, 7};
        boolean s=bijiao(arr,arr1);
        System.out.println(s);

    }

    public static boolean bijiao(int[] arr1, int[] arr2) {

        if (arr1.length != arr2.length) {
            return false;
        }
        int s = 0;
        for (int i = 0; i < arr1.length; i++) {
            if (arr1[i] != arr2[i]) {
                return false;
            }
        }
        return true;
    }
}



package zuoye0329;
//参数  int int[] arr
//返回值类型 int

import java.util.Scanner;

public class text12 {
    public static void main(String[] args) {
        int[] arr=new int[6];
        Scanner sc=new Scanner(System.in);
        for(int i=0;i<arr.length;i++){
            System.out.println("请第"+(i+1)+"个评委开始打分");
            arr[i]=sc.nextInt();
        }
        double total=(double)(Sum(arr)-Max(arr)-Min(arr))/4;
        System.out.println(total);

    }

    public static int Max(int[] arr) {
        //最大值
        int max = arr[0];
        for (int i = 1; i < arr.length; i++) {
            if (max < arr[i]) {
                max = arr[i];
            }
        }
        return max;
    }

    public static int Min(int[] arr) {
        //最小值
        int min = arr[0];
        for (int i = 0; i < arr.length; i++) {
            if (min > arr[i]) {
                min = arr[i];
            }
        }
        return min;
    }

    public static int Sum(int[] arr) {
        //总分
        int sum = 0;
        for (int i = 0; i < arr.length; i++) {
            sum = sum + arr[i];
        }
        return sum;
    }


}

0 个回复

您需要登录后才可以回帖 登录 | 加入黑马